Freelance iPad Developer Secrets
You'll want to see a little, black archery icon in excess of our significant, blue circle – it’s the best notion, nevertheless it doesn’t look good.
string. This suggests the string might not be there, so it’s not Safe and sound to assign to the chosen house.
Second, instead of usually demonstrating a blue qualifications, we will select a random color every time. This normally takes two measures, commencing having a new house of all the colors we wish to pick from – put this beside the routines property:
This could make it animate the outdated VStack currently being taken out plus a new VStack getting additional, instead of just the person sights inside it. A lot better, we could Management how that add and take away changeover occurs using a changeover() modifier, that has a variety of developed-in transitions we can use.
Just as much fun as archery is, this application definitely must counsel a random action to buyers rather than always demonstrating the exact same thing. Which means incorporating two new Attributes to our watch: a person to store the assortment of possible functions, and one particular to show whichever just one is at present becoming advisable.
Should you add several spacers, they're going to divide the Place equally concerning them. If you are trying putting a 2nd spacer ahead of the “Why don't you try…†text you’ll see what I indicate – SwiftUI will generate and equal quantity of Area above the text and underneath the action identify.
as an alternative to being forced to edit the code every time, so we’re planning to increase a button below our inner VStack that could alter the selected exercise each time it’s pressed. This is still Within the outer VStack, although, meaning It will likely be arranged down below the title and activity icon.
Around that blue circle we’re likely to put an icon displaying the activity we endorse. iOS includes a number of thousand totally free icons identified as SF Symbols
Earlier I made you build an internal VStack to house Mobile Development Freelance those a few views, and now you could see why: we’re gonna tell SwiftUI that these sights may be source determined as a single group, and which the group’s identifier can change after a while.
SwiftUI will help you Construct wonderful-on the lookout apps throughout all Apple platforms with the strength of Swift — and incredibly very little code. You are able to bring even better ordeals to Every person, on any Apple system, utilizing just one set of tools and APIs.
Share extra of your SwiftUI code together with your watchOS apps. Scroll vertical TabViews using the crown, match colors with adaptive track record containers, make the most of edge-to-edge shows with new ToolbarItem placements, and leverage NavigationSplitView to make detailed record views.
And now you'll want to begin to see the structure you predicted before: our archery icon above the text “Archery!â€.
On the right-hand side of Xcode, you’ll see a Are living preview of that code managing – when you make a modify towards the code to the left, it'll seem from the preview straight away. If you can’t begin to see the preview, stick to these Recommendations to empower it.
SwiftUI makes it straightforward to get rolling employing SwiftData with just a single line of code. Knowledge modeled with @Product is observed by SwiftUI routinely. @Question efficiently fetches filtered and sorted information on your views and refreshes in reaction to variations.